How do I negotiate my automotive maintenance technician salary?
Research comparable roles in your area, document your accomplishments, and arrive at negotiations with data. Use total compensation (base + bonus + equity + benefits) as your benchmark, not just base pay.
What factors affect automotive maintenance technician compensation in california?
Key factors include years of experience, technical certifications, company size (startup vs. enterprise), industry (tech vs. finance vs. healthcare), and whether the role is remote-first or on-site in a high cost-of-living metro.
